Interview Angela Verdenius

by

Shannon Greenland

 

How long have you been writing?

Since I was about ten years old! But I started writing romance about four years ago.

Have you always wanted to be a writer?

Oh yeah. It’s the best!

What are your other hobbies?

Cross-stitch, reading, animal welfare (especially cats) & movies. COUCH POTATOE!

When do you write? Everyday? Bi-weekly?

Almost every day. Sometimes I miss a day here and there when I’m doing nightshift, but even then, I usually manage a few lines before I leave for work. Days off are when I do most of my writing, and then it is all day.

Where do you get your ideas?

Music inspires me. It could be just a few words, a couple of lines, even a whole song. Sometimes it’s just the tune.
